Primary Outcome Measures
NameTimeMethod
Serum Levels of Sex Hormones. Timepoint: Before Taking the Drug and 10 Weeks After Taking the Drug. Method of measurement: Eliza Kit.;Sperm Parameters. Timepoint: Before Taking the Drug and 10 Weeks After Taking the Drug. Method of measurement: Standard Clinical Analysis of Semen for Evaluation of Sperm Parameters with The Usual Laboratory Method and Light Microscope According to the Organization CriteriaWHO-2010 World Health Takes Place.;Oxidative Stress Rate. Timepoint: Before Taking the Drug and 10 Weeks After Taking the Drug. Method of measurement: ROS Positive Sperms were Evaluated Using H2DCFDA (DCFH - DA: 2 ', 7'-dichlorodihydrofluoresceindiacetat) (Sigma Co., USA) and Analyzed by Flow Cytometry.
Secondary Outcome Measures
NameTimeMethod
Viability. Timepoint: Before Taking the Drug and 10 Weeks After Taking the Drug. Method of measurement: Viability is Assessed by Eosin-Nigrosin Staining and Examined Using a Light Microscope.;DNA Damage Assessment. Timepoint: Before Taking the Drug and 10 Weeks After Taking the Drug. Method of measurement: Tunnel Kit.;Measurement of Sperm Mitochondrial Activity. Timepoint: Before Taking the Drug and 10 Weeks After Taking the Drug. Method of measurement: Rhodamine Staining is Used to Assess the Mitochondrial Activity of Sperm.
